[ARCHIVED] Cool in the Pool

Due to the current heat wave our pool staff at the Falls Aquatic Center is doing everything possible to keep the water temperature in the low 80’s so the water remains refreshing for patrons to use. Any adult or child entering the Facility after 5:30 PM on Thursday July 5 or Friday July 6 will be allowed admission to the Falls in exchange for a 20 pound bag of ice or larger. The ice will be collected and dumped into one of the pools by the staff. Patrons with season passes or those wanting to pay the daily rate of $5.00 for youth, 3-17 years old or $6.00 for adults 18 or older will still be allowed to swim as well.

For more information, contact the Cedar Falls Rec Center @ 273-8636, or the Falls Aquatic Center, located on the corner of South Main and Jennings Drive in Cedar Falls @ 266-8468.
